No, there is no direct bus from Luton station to Poole station. However, there are services departing from Luton Station Interchange and arriving at Seldown Coach Station via Heathrow Central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 40m.
No, there is no direct train from Luton to Poole. However, there are services departing from Luton and arriving at Poole via West Hampstead station and London Waterloo.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 17m.
The distance between Luton and Poole is 146 miles. The road distance is 125.6 miles.
